Barack Obama will begin airing his first general election campaign ads in 18 states, including New Hampshire, the campaign announced today.
The 60 second ad titled "Country I Love" is biographical in nature.
You can watch it below.
Yesterday, John McCain chose New Hampshire as one of 11 states to run an advertisement on global warming.
John McCain's campaign was less than impressed.
"We’re confident the more Americans know about Barack Obama the less likely they are to support him," said McCain spokesman Tucker Bounds.
